Wrong Leads Being Found

3 min readUpdated 2026-07-18

Key Takeaway

Wrong leads almost always trace back to vague targeting or a vague goal. Add 2-3 qualifying criteria to your audience, then give your agent direct chat feedback and give it a day to adjust.

If your agent keeps finding leads that don't fit, here's how to diagnose it and fix it.

Step 1: Review your targeting

Vague targeting is the most common cause:

Problem Example Fix
Too broad an industry "Services" Get specific: "Plumbing services"
No location limit "United States" Narrow it: "Portland, OR metro area"
Vague criteria "Small businesses" Get specific: "5-20 employees"
Missing qualifiers "Restaurants" Add one: "Restaurants without a website"

Step 2: Check your campaign goal

Your goal steers the lead search. A vague goal produces vague results.

Before: "Find potential clients in the area"

After: "Find family-owned pizza restaurants in downtown Portland that don't have online ordering"

Step 3: Give your agent direct feedback

Open chat and just tell it what's wrong:

  • "The last 5 leads were all franchises, I only work with independent businesses"
  • "Stop finding businesses outside the Portland metro area"
  • "I need businesses with a physical location, not online-only companies"

Your agent adjusts its search based on this.

Step 4: Review and mark leads

Go to your Leads page and:

  1. Review what your agent has found so far
  2. Mark irrelevant leads as "Not a fit," this teaches your agent
  3. Look for a pattern between the good leads and the bad ones
  4. Use that pattern to tighten your goal further

Common lead quality issues

Issue Likely cause Solution
Wrong industry Broad industry targeting Narrow the industry definition
Too far away No location constraint Add a city or area to the goal
Enterprise companies No size filter Mention "small businesses" in the goal
Defunct businesses Stale public data Your agent verifies before outreach, report if it persists
Leads already using a competitor Natural overlap Mention competitors to avoid, in chat
